On 2010-06-10 15:01, Sascha Mäkelä <sascha.mak...@gmail.com> wrote:

Hi,

I just made a Debian package of my app. I'm using QtSql in it. But for
some
reason when I install the package, all the SQL things don't work. My guess
is that I'm missing something in the Build-Depends line in the control
file.
How can I check what libs I need to add there and what are their correct
names?

Cheers,
Sascha

PS. Currently it's like this: Build-Depends: dephelper (>5), libqt4-dev,
libqt4-network


You need to add the relevant Qt SQL provider packages to the ‘Depends:’
line, not the ‘Build-Depends:’ line, as the SQL providers are plugins that
are not required at build time, but at runtime. You probably want
libqt4-sql-mysql or libqt4-sql-sqlite in Depends, depending on which
database provider you are using.
